Basketball Coaches Undergo Training

A seven-day training course for 21 Inter-School Sports Association (ISSA) Basketball Coaches is taking place from 2 – 9 March 2010

The training course, which is organized by the International Olympic Committee (IOC) through the Liberia National Olympic Committee (LNOC), is the first for high-school Basketball Coaches in Liberia and eleventh edition since the last eight months.

The training is being facilitated by a Senegalese Basketball expert, M. Sano Seydou, who is also s an executive committee member of IOC.   He is offering lectures on the fundamentals of f Basketball, the new rules of the game among others.

Speaking during the opening of the course, Liberia National Olympic Committee (LNOC) Vice President, Mr. Sylvester Rennie, urged participants to take advantage of the opportunity and sell the new ideas to be learned to their players.

 

Mr. Rennie added that the training is the result of the Liberia National Olympic Committee’s desire to strengthen the technical aspects of its various federations.

For his part, the chief Scribe of the LNOC and the President of ISSA, Joseph Willie, praised IOC/LNOC and the Liberia Basketball Federation for continuously organizing such training courses for Liberian Basket Ball Coaches.

He said learning is very important, and against this backdrop, he challenged them to take advantage of the e training. According to him, the initiative will enhance their capacities if taken seriously. 

Meanwhile, Mr. Seydou and officials of the LBF will today, Friday tour the Basketball Gymnasium currently construction at the Samuel K. Doe Sports Complex in Paynesville City, outside e Monrovia.

The tour is aimed at ensuring that proper   mechanisms are being put in place for the successful hosting of Zone 3 FIBBA here.
